Truck Ramming Injures 29 in Central Israel; Separate Stabbing Incident Reported Near Jerusalem

A truck driver intentionally rammed his vehicle into a crowd waiting at a bus stop in central Israel on Sunday, injuring at least 29 people, according to police and medical officials. The incident occurred on Ahron Yariv Boulevard in Ramat Hasharon, close to the bustling commercial area of Tel Aviv.

Preliminary police findings revealed that the truck also collided with a bus that was stopped at the same location to drop off passengers. Emergency service provider Magen David Adom reported that six individuals sustained serious injuries among the total injured.

While police have not confirmed the incident as a terrorist attack, they stated that civilians at the scene “shot the truck driver and neutralised him.” Paramedic Elior Yosef, who was among the first responders, recounted witnessing eight people trapped under the truck. “A number of further casualties were either lying or walking near the truck,” he added.

First responders, including police and ambulances, quickly arrived at the site, where journalists observed the area cordoned off as medics assisted the injured. A helicopter hovered above the scene during the response.

The Palestinian militant group Hamas claimed responsibility for what they termed a “heroic ramming attack,” stating it was a response to “crimes committed by the Zionist occupation” against Palestinians.

In a separate incident near Jerusalem, Israeli soldiers shot and killed a man who attempted to stab them during a counterterrorism operation in Hizma. The military described the incident as a “terror attack,” stating that the assailant accelerated his vehicle toward the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) soldiers and pulled out a knife in an attempt to carry out the attack. Fortunately, no soldiers were injured in this incident.

Since the outbreak of the war in Gaza on October 7, 2023, there have been numerous attacks in Israel attributed to Palestinian militants. According to an AFP tally based on official Israeli figures, at least 30 people, including Israeli soldiers, have been killed in such attacks since the onset of hostilities.

The incidents occurred on a day when Israel was holding ceremonies to mark the anniversary of the October 7 Hamas attack, which ignited the ongoing conflicts in Gaza and Lebanon. As tensions continue to rise in the region, authorities remain on high alert to prevent further violence.
